Description Max Sauer 2005-06-13 15:16:24 UTC
While opening a project and scannning it's classpath, multiple exceptions
pop-up. The classpath scannning ends in a never ending loop and the IDE becomes
unusable due to constant loosing of focus coused by the pop-up exception alerts.
I already reproduced this multiple times on different projects, using fresh
userdirs.

I'll one of the projects, in case it has smtg to do with this issue (altough I
don't think so), and a screen shot for better description of how it looks like.

Steps to reproduce: 
--------------------
1)Run the IDE with fresh userdir
2)Try to open a project

System Specs:
--------------
Solaris 10 on Sparc, JDS3 desktop
JDK 1.5.0_03
NB 4.2dev 200506121800

Comment 4 Max Sauer 2005-06-13 15:39:54 UTC
I've reproduced it for a few other times, this is the exception which is shown
in the pop-up window:

java.lang.NullPointerException
	at org.netbeans.modules.javacore.JMManager.scanFiles(JMManager.java:1049)
	at org.netbeans.modules.javacore.JMManager.resolveCPRoot(JMManager.java:978)
	at org.netbeans.modules.javacore.JMManager.resolveCodebases(JMManager.java:792)
	at org.netbeans.modules.javacore.JMManager$2.run(JMManager.java:746)
	at org.openide.util.Task.run(Task.java:207)
	at org.openide.util.RequestProcessor$Task.run(RequestProcessor.java:435)
[catch] at
org.openide.util.RequestProcessor$Processor.run(RequestProcessor.java:836)
